Summary
The bill eliminates Title 30, chapter 8 and Title 40, chapter 3 of the Arizona Revised Statutes and revises the scope of Chapter 47, which governs security interests. While most security interests remain covered, the amendment lists dozens of exceptions, including landlord liens, wage assignments, certain insurance and government transfers. The goal is to limit the state's regulation of those excluded transactions.
